  13. What is Gauge Pressure - Definition - Thermal Engineering

    https://www.thermal-engineering.org/what-is-gauge-pressure-definition

    WebMay 22, 2019 · When pressure is measured relative to atmospheric pressure (14.7 psi), it is called gauge pressure (psig). The term gauge pressure is applied when the pressure in the system is greater than the local atmospheric pressure, p atm. The latter pressure scale was developed because almost all pressure gauges register zero when open to the atmosphere.

  14. Strain Gauge and Gauge Factor - Electrical Concepts

    https://electricalbaba.com/strain-gauge-gauge-factor

    WebJan 07, 2018 · Thus Strain Gauge converts stress / strain into resistance. Gauge Factor: Gauge Factor is defined as the ratio of per unit change in resistance to the per unit change in length. This can be mathematically written as, G f = (ΔR / R) / (ΔL / L) Where. ΔR / R = Per unit change in resistance. ΔL / L = Per unit change in length. G f = Gauge Factor
